> seriously, who still uses RT 3.0? RT 3.6 is current, and the beta of
> the next major version just came out.
And RT 3.6.6 is available in ports (www/rt36). I personally think rt3
should be marked for deletion. 3.0.12 was the last release from the 3.0
series and was released close to 4 years ago without an update to that branch
since then.
However, since someone stepped up to maintain it, I guess if they can fix the
port so it no longer uses a random gid, might as well keep it around.
